"Hold Up" is a song recorded by American singer Beyoncé for her sixth studio album, Lemonade (2016). The song was serviced to rhythmic radios in the United States on August 16, 2016 as the third single from the album. It was written by Diplo, Ezra Koenig, Beyoncé, Emile Haynie, Josh Tillman, MNEK and MeLo-X.

"Hold Up" (stylized in uppercase) is the second track and third single from Beyoncé's sixth studio album, Lemonade. It was released through Parkwood Entertainment on April 23, 2016 and premiered in the album's short film special on the same day. lyrics artistfacts Songfacts®: Lemonade is a concept album, where Beyoncé recounts a story of discovering and wrestling with her husband's infidelity. This is the second track, by which stage her suspicions have been aroused.
